Alex looked at an electric toothbrush that had a plug with three metal prongs. Why are these prongs made out of metal?
Metal doesn’t get hot and melt when you plug it into the outlet.
Metal is strong and is less likely to break when you plug it into the outlet.
Metal is an insulator and prevents shocks when you plug it into the outlet.
Metal is a conductor and completes a circuit when you plug it into the outlet.

Which would be a good conductor of electricity?
a rubber band
a piece of paper
a penny
a mirror

What material would be safest to use as an insulator to cover electrical wires?
Aluminum
Tin
Rubber
Water

Two students design a circuit that includes a switch, a battery and light bulb all directly connected by wires. Before flipping the switch, what could the students do to BEST ensure that it will work?
clean the wires
check the brightness of the bulb
reverse the direction of the wires
make sure there is a complete path

A student is constructing four different electrical circuits. Each circuit has a battery, wires, a switch, and a light bulb. Which of the following is the best way for the student to record information so that another student can construct exactly the same four circuits?
draw a diagram that shows each circuit
make a tally of the parts used in each circuit
make a list of the materials needed for each circuit
create a graph that shows the number of parts in each circuit

Which components could complete an electric circuit?
wire, bulb, switch
battery, bulb, switch
battery, wire, switch
battery, wire, bulb
